云服务器怎么架设网站,云服务器如何建立网站
- 综合资讯
- 2024-09-30 00:09:09
- 3

***:本内容聚焦于云服务器架设网站相关。云服务器架设网站需多步骤操作,首先要选择合适的云服务器提供商,依据自身需求确定配置。然后进行域名注册并备案(国内)。在云服务器...
***:主要探讨云服务器架设网站的相关内容。首先需选择合适的云服务器,考虑配置、带宽等因素。接着安装操作系统,如Linux或Windows Server。然后进行域名注册并将域名解析到云服务器IP地址。在服务器上安装Web服务器软件,像Apache或IIS。再根据网站需求搭建数据库,如MySQL等。之后上传网站程序代码到服务器指定目录,最后进行必要的配置调试,使网站能正常运行。
本文目录导读:
《云服务器建立网站全攻略》
随着互联网的发展,越来越多的个人和企业选择使用云服务器来建立自己的网站,云服务器具有灵活、可扩展、成本低等诸多优点,以下是在云服务器上建立网站的详细步骤:
选择云服务器
1、确定需求
- 在选择云服务器之前,需要明确网站的类型、预计的流量、对服务器性能的要求等,如果是一个小型的个人博客,可能只需要较低配置的云服务器;而如果是一个大型的电子商务网站,就需要较高的计算能力、存储容量和网络带宽。
- 考虑可扩展性,以便在网站流量增长时能够轻松升级服务器资源。
2、选择云服务提供商
- 市场上有许多云服务提供商,如阿里云、腾讯云、亚马逊AWS等,需要比较它们的价格、服务质量、数据中心分布等因素。
- 查看提供商的口碑和用户评价,了解其技术支持的响应速度和有效性。
配置云服务器
1、操作系统选择
- 常见的操作系统有Linux(如Ubuntu、CentOS)和Windows Server,Linux系统在服务器领域应用广泛,具有稳定性高、安全性好、开源等优点,适合大多数网站,Windows Server则更适合运行基于.NET框架开发的网站,对于习惯Windows环境的用户也比较友好。
2、安装必要软件
- 如果选择Linux系统,需要安装Web服务器软件,如Apache或Nginx,Apache是最流行的开源Web服务器之一,具有丰富的功能和广泛的模块支持,Nginx则以高性能、低内存占用和出色的并发处理能力而闻名。
- 安装数据库管理系统,如MySQL或PostgreSQL,MySQL是一种广泛使用的开源数据库,适用于大多数中小型网站的数据库需求。
- 对于动态网站,可能还需要安装相应的编程语言环境,如PHP、Python或Ruby。
域名注册与解析
1、域名注册
- 选择一个合适的域名注册商,如GoDaddy、万网等,域名要简洁易记,与网站内容或品牌相关。
- 按照注册商的流程注册域名,通常需要提供一些个人或企业信息,并支付一定的注册费用。
2、域名解析
- 在注册商的控制面板中,将域名解析到云服务器的IP地址,这一步骤是将域名与服务器建立关联,使得用户在浏览器中输入域名时能够访问到服务器上的网站内容。
网站开发与部署
1、网站开发
- 如果是自己开发网站,可以使用各种开发工具和框架,对于静态网站,可以使用HTML、CSS和JavaScript进行开发,对于动态网站,根据选择的编程语言(如PHP + MySQL开发一个简单的内容管理系统)进行代码编写。
- 确保网站的设计符合用户体验原则,页面布局合理,加载速度快。
2、部署网站
- 将开发好的网站文件上传到云服务器,如果是Linux系统,可以使用SFTP(安全文件传输协议)工具,如FileZilla进行上传。
- 对于基于Web框架开发的动态网站,需要按照框架的部署要求进行配置,例如设置虚拟主机、调整权限等。
网站安全设置
1、防火墙配置
- 在云服务器上配置防火墙,只允许必要的端口访问,对于Web服务器,通常只需要开放80(HTTP)或443(HTTPS)端口。
- 阻止来自恶意IP地址的访问,防止网络攻击。
2、安全更新
- 定期更新操作系统、Web服务器软件、数据库管理系统等的安全补丁,以修复已知的安全漏洞。
网站性能优化
优化
- 优化网站的图片、脚本和样式表,减小文件大小,提高页面加载速度。
- 采用内容分发网络(CDN),将静态资源分布到全球多个节点,加速用户访问。
2、服务器性能优化
- 调整Web服务器的配置参数,如Apache的MaxClients或Nginx的worker_processes,以提高服务器的并发处理能力。
- 对数据库进行优化,如创建索引、优化查询语句等,提高数据库的读写性能。
通过以上步骤,就可以在云服务器上成功建立一个网站,在整个过程中,需要不断学习和积累经验,以确保网站的稳定运行和良好的用户体验。
本文链接:https://www.zhitaoyun.cn/55548.html
发表评论